President Mohamud to Hold Talks With Opposition Leaders Next Month

GOOBJOOG NEWS|MOGADISHU: Current and former national leaders will convene for a special meeting next month amid heightened political tensions in the country.

State Minister for Foreign Affairs Ali Omar said Friday President Hassan Sheikh Mohamud will convene the meeting to discuss major issues of concern in the country but did not state any particular dates.

Noting that there was a need for dialogue amid ongoing political disputes, the minister said the meeting wil bring together members of the opposition, some of whom are former presidents and prime ministers.

The meeting comes amid accusations against the government and President Mohamud by the opposition over a number of issues including election models and preparations for the 2026 presidential elections.

Opposition key figures among them former prime minister Hassan Khaire, Omar Abdirashid and former president Sharif Sheikh Ahmed held meetings in Mogadishu on Saturday in what they said was a first in a series of consultations.
